What is the solution set for the inequality 3(5- x)<5x-17

Answer:

The answer is : x>4

Step-by-step explanation:

3(5-x)<5x-17

15-3x<5x-17

-3x-5x<-17-15

-(3x+5x)<-(17+15)

3x+5x>17+15

8x>32

x>[tex]\frac{32}{8}[/tex]

x>4
